Removal

Compressor

1. Disconnect ground cable from battery.
2. Discharge refrigerant using refrigerant recovery system.
1. Fully close low-pressure valve of manifold gauge.
2. Connect low-pressure charging hose of manifold gauge to low-pressure service valve.




3. Open low-pressure manifold gauge valve slightly, and slowly discharge refrigerant from system.

CAUTION: Do not allow refrigerant to rush out. Otherwise, compressor oil will be discharged along with refrigerant.




3. Remove low-pressure hose (A) (Flexible hose Ps) and high-pressure hose (B) (Flexible hose Pd).

CAUTION:
- Be careful not to lose O-ring of low-pressure hose.
- Plug the opening to prevent foreign matter from entering.




4. Compressor belt cover and generator belt cover:
Remove bolts which secure belt covers.

5. Remove alternator V-belt:
1. Loosen lock bolt on generator bracket.




2. Turn adjusting bolt and remove V-belt.

6. Remove compressor V-belt:
1. Loosen lock bolt on idler pulley.




2. Turn adjusting bolt and remove V-belt.




7. Disconnect alternator harness.
8. Disconnect compressor harness:
Disconnect compressor harness from body harness.




9. Remove lower bracket:
Remove bolts which secure lower compressor bracket.

10. Remove compressor:
1. Remove bolts which secure compressor.




2. Remove compressor from bracket.
